 The following is unexpected:
 {{{
 sage: A.<n> = AsymptoticRing('QQ^n * n^QQ', SR)
 sage: 2^n
 Traceback (most recent call last):
 ...
 ArithmeticError: Cannot construct 2^n in Growth Group QQ^n * n^QQ
 > *previous* TypeError: unsupported operand parent(s) for '*':
 'Growth Group QQ^n * n^QQ' and 'Growth Group SR^n'
 }}}
 The only work-around I found until now is
 {{{
 sage: A(AsymptoticRing(growth_group='QQ^n', coefficient_ring=ZZ)('2^n'))
 2^n
 }}}
